How much do email marketing operations man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 19, 2026, the average yearly pay for email marketing operations manager in Riverside, CA is $98,983.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$91,800.00 and $106,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an email marketing operations manager do?

An Email Marketing Operations Manager oversees the planning, execution, and optimization of email marketing campaigns. Their responsibilities include managing email lists, ensuring deliverability, analyzing campaign performance, and maintaining compliance with regulations like GDPR and CAN-SPAM. They work closely with marketing teams to create effective strategies, implement automation, and use analytics to improve engagement and conversion rates.

What are some common challenges faced by an email marketing operations manager when coordinating campaigns across multiple teams?

Email Marketing Operations Managers often face the challenge of aligning messaging, timelines, and data requirements across marketing, design, content, and IT teams. Coordinating these elements requires strong project management skills and clear communication to avoid delays or inconsistencies in campaigns. Additionally, ensuring compliance with data privacy regulations and maintaining list hygiene can add complexity, especially when managing multiple campaigns simultaneously. Proactively setting expectations, using collaborative tools, and establishing streamlined workflows can help mitigate these challenges.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an email marketing operations man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Email Marketing Operations Manager, you need expertise in digital marketing strategies, campaign management, and a strong understanding of email compliance regulations, often supported by a degree in marketing or similar field. Familiarity with email marketing platforms (such as Salesforce Marketing Cloud, Mailchimp, or HubSpot), analytics tools, and CRM systems is typically required, along with certifications like HubSpot Email Marketing or Salesforce Certified Marketing Cloud Email Specialist. Strong project management,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help you excel in coordinating teams and optimizing campaign performance. These skills and qualifications are vital to drive engagement, maintain brand reputation, and achieve measurable business outcomes through targeted email campaigns.

What is the difference between Email Marketing Operations Manager vs Email Marketing Specialist?

AspectEmail Marketing Operations ManagerEmail Marketing Specialist
ResponsibilitiesOversees email campaign workflows, manages automation, ensures technical setup, and optimizes email systems.Creates email content, designs campaigns, segments audiences, and analyzes campaign performance.
Required SkillsTechnical knowledge of email platforms, automation tools, data analysis, and project management.Copywriting, design skills, segmentation, and basic analytics.
CredentialsOften requires marketing certifications or technical training in email platforms.Marketing or communications degrees, with certifications like HubSpot or Mailchimp preferred.
Work EnvironmentTypically in marketing teams within digital agencies, e-commerce, or corporate marketing departments.

The Email Marketing Operations Manager focuses on managing the technical and operational aspects of email campaigns, ensuring systems run smoothly and efficiently. In contrast, the Email Marketing Specialist concentrates on content creation and campaign execution. Both roles often collaborate but serve different functions within email marketing strategies.

Job description

We are seeking a detail-oriented and results-driven Email Marketing Specialist to join our marketing team. The ideal candidate has hands-on experience managing email marketing platforms and understands how to translate marketing goals into targeted, data-driven campaigns that drive engagement and lead generation.

This role is for a self-starter who can manage multiple campaigns, partner cross-functionally with marketing, sales, and IT stakeholders, and ensure email communications are optimized, compliant, and aligned with business objectives. The Email Marketing Specialist will develop, execute, and optimize email campaigns, manage audience segmentation, and support lead lifecycle initiatives. Str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and a passion for performance marketing are essential.

This is a fully remote role.

 

Responsibilities

  • Develop, build, and execute email marketing campaigns, including newsletters and nurture programs, and events.
  • Manage and optimize Marketing Cloud Account Engagement for audience segmentation, list management, and campaign deployment.
  • Collaborate with content, digital, and design teams to create compelling email content aligned with campaign objectives and brand standards.
  • Monitor and analyze campaign performance, including open rates, click-through rates, conversions, and deliverability metrics; provide actionable insights and recommendations.
  • Create and maintain automated nurture programs and drip campaigns to support lead lifecycle and conversion goals.
  • Ensure email campaigns follow best practices for deliverability, compliance (CAN-SPAM, GDPR), and accessibility standards.
  • Support A/B testing strategies to optimize subject lines, content, send times, and targeting approaches.
  • Maintain data quality and segmentation accuracy within email lists; troubleshoot issues related to list hygiene and campaign deployment.
  • Partner with Salesforce teams to ensure alignment between email campaigns, CRM data, and lead tracking.
  • Document campaign processes, best practices, and workflows; provide support and training to marketing stakeholders as needed.
  • Stay current on email marketing trends, platform updates, and industry best practices, recommending improvements as needed.
 

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Marketing, Communications, Business, or a related field.
  • 2–4 years of hands-on experience in email marketing, marketing automation, or digital marketing.
  • Experience with Marketing Cloud Account Engagement (Pardot) or similar email marketing platforms preferred.
  • Strong understanding of email marketing best practices, including segmentation, personalization, and deliverability.
  • Experience building and analyzing marketing campaigns, including reporting and performance optimization.
  • Familiarity with CRM systems such as Salesforce and lead lifecycle management processes.
  • Strong analytical skills with the ability to translate data into actionable insights.
  • Excellent communication and project management skills, with the ability to manage multiple campaigns simultaneously.
  • High attention to detail and strong organizational skills.
  • Familiarity with tools such as Marketing Cloud, Beefree, Figma, and Microsoft Office preferred.
